CVE-2022-48520 is an unauthorized access vulnerability in the SystemUI module of Huawei EMUI and HarmonyOS, potentially compromising confidentiality. With a CVSS score of 7.5 (High), it can be exploited remotely with low complexity, requiring no user interaction. Despite its high severity, there is currently no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code, or significant community discussion surrounding this vulnerability.
